I'm ready to be corrected on this, but Singers are a very different proposition. You need to buy a RHD car over here (though they can do that), then it gets shipped to LA, they do all the work which you pay for, then it gets shipped back and you have to pay import duty on the value of the work they've done. Might be different now they have a UK base for the DLS stuff.Gassing Station | Readers' Cars | Top of Page | What's New | My Stuff
